SA Talke Wins Saudi Polymer Logistics Contract

SA Talke, a joint venture between Germany’s Talke Group and Saudi Industrial Services (SISCO), has been awarded a contract to carry out on-site logistics for National Petrochemical Industrial Company (NATPET) in Yanbu, Saudi Arabia.

The contract is effective from Jan. 1 2016 and initially runs for a period of three years. SA Talke will be responsible for product handling – namely polypropylene – and warehouse management. NATPET, a subsidiary of Alujain Corp, produces 400,000 t/y of both propylene and polypropylene at Yanbu.

SA Talke said the contract extends its reach from its traditional core area of Al-Jubail on Saudi Arabia’s east coast to the country’s western province.
